I did e-mail them, but given my less than stellar success in eliciting e-mail responses from a couple of other guest houses, I wasn't optimistic that Castara Retreats would respond. I was pleasantly surprised to receive a very quick response, though. As it turns out, two of the four units do have hammocks - Rainforest and Fisherman's Cottage. It's my impression that hammocks for the other two are being looked into. Yay!

So far, I'm very favorably impressed with the customer service.
